Healthy Zucchini Fritters – Side Dish Recipe

  • Total Time: 25 minutes
  • Yield: 4 servings
  • Diet: Vegetarian

These Healthy Zucchini Fritters are light, crispy, and packed with flavor. Perfect as a side dish or snack, they combine fresh zucchini, herbs, and a touch of cheese for a wholesome bite.


Ingredients

  • 2 medium zucchinis, grated
  • 2 large eggs
  • 1/4 cup oat flour (or almond flour for low-carb option)
  • 1/4 cup grated Parmesan cheese (optional)
  • 1/4 cup plain Greek yogurt or cottage cheese
  • 1 garlic clove, finely minced
  • 1/4 teaspoon sea salt
  • 1/4 teaspoon black pepper
  • 1/2 teaspoon dried oregano or thyme
  • 2 tablespoons chopped fresh parsley or dill
  • 1 tablespoon olive oil or olive oil spray for pan-frying


Instructions

  1. Grate the zucchinis and squeeze out excess moisture using a clean kitchen towel or cheesecloth.
  2. In a mixing bowl, combine zucchini, eggs, oat flour, Parmesan, Greek yogurt, garlic, salt, pepper, oregano, and parsley. Mix until well combined.
  3. Heat olive oil in a skillet over medium heat.
  4. Spoon the mixture into the skillet to form small fritters.
  5. Cook 3–4 minutes per side, or until golden brown and cooked through.
  6. Drain on paper towels and serve warm.

Notes

  • For extra crispiness, allow the fritters to rest for 5 minutes before frying.
  • Serve with a dollop of Greek yogurt or your favorite dipping sauce.
  • Can be made ahead and reheated in a skillet or oven.
  • Prep Time: 15 minutes
  • Cook Time: 10 minutes
